**Navigating the Code-Verse: Your Practical Guide to a Thriving Developer Career (Explaining the 'How' & Sharing Practical Tips)**
Embarking on a developer career isn't just about writing elegant code; it's about understanding the entire ecosystem that fuels innovation. This section delves into the 'how' – how to strategically build your skill set, how to effectively market yourself, and how to continuously evolve in a rapidly changing tech landscape. We'll explore practical approaches to mastering new languages and frameworks, moving beyond theoretical knowledge to hands-on application. Expect actionable advice on choosing your specialization, whether it's front-end wizardry, robust back-end architecture, or cutting-edge data science, ensuring your learning journey aligns with your career aspirations and market demands. This isn't just theory; it's your roadmap to tangible success.
Beyond the technical prowess, a thriving developer career hinges on crucial soft skills and strategic networking. We'll unpack practical tips for excelling in technical interviews, from crafting a compelling resume to acing whiteboard challenges and behavioral questions. Furthermore, we'll guide you on building a strong online presence through platforms like GitHub and LinkedIn, showcasing your projects and expertise. Expect insights into effective communication within agile teams, mastering version control, and contributing meaningfully to open-source projects. This holistic approach ensures you're not just a coder, but a valuable team player and a recognized professional in the highly competitive code-verse.
- Prioritize continuous learning
- Network strategically
- Showcase your work effectively
Erhan Çelenk is a prominent figure in Turkish football, known for his impactful presence as a player and his subsequent contributions to the sport. Throughout his career, Erhan Çelenk demonstrated remarkable skill and dedication, earning him recognition among fans and peers. His journey in football reflects a deep passion and commitment to the game in Turkey.
**Beyond the Syntax: Decoding Developer Life – Common Questions & Erhan's Insights on Growth & Challenges**
Delving into the multifaceted world of software development often sparks numerous questions, particularly for those aspiring to thrive in this dynamic field. Developers, from fresh graduates to seasoned veterans like Erhan, consistently grapple with themes of continuous learning, technological obsolescence, and the ever-present demand for problem-solving. It's not merely about writing elegant code; it's about understanding business logic, collaborating effectively, and adapting to new paradigms. Common inquiries often revolve around skill acquisition ("What programming languages should I learn?"), career progression ("How do I move from junior to senior developer?"), and maintaining relevance in a rapidly evolving landscape. Erhan's insights, honed through years of experience, frequently highlight the importance of foundational knowledge over fleeting trends, emphasizing a growth mindset as the ultimate differentiator.
Erhan's perspective on growth and challenges in developer life extends beyond mere technical proficiency. He often stresses the crucial role of soft skills, such as effective communication, empathy, and the ability to give and receive constructive feedback. The challenges, he notes, aren't solely debugging complex systems but also navigating team dynamics and managing project expectations. For instance, he might advise:
"Don't just fix the bug; understand why it occurred and how to prevent future occurrences."This holistic approach to development underscores the idea that a truly successful developer is a well-rounded professional. His insights frequently touch upon:
- The necessity for continuous self-assessment and improvement.
- The value of mentorship and peer learning.
- Developing resilience in the face of setbacks.
These principles, Erhan believes, are far more enduring than any specific framework or language.